Commit Graph

  • b9f123fbea fix: use corresponding identifier Andres Rodriguez 2023-08-17 19:59:11 -04:00
  • 2944d00ca2 Refactoring so that no file needs to be introduced KnugiHK 2023-08-15 17:40:20 +08:00
  • 448ba892cc Change the option from --smb to --business KnugiHK 2023-08-15 17:33:56 +08:00
  • a5cb46e095 Also make vcard path dynamic in Android KnugiHK 2023-08-15 16:22:43 +08:00
  • ee4e95c75f Bug fix on the possible breakage mentioned in #60 KnugiHK 2023-08-15 16:22:08 +08:00
  • f488894942 fix(whatsapp_business): missing domain ref Andres Rodriguez 2023-08-15 00:46:54 -04:00
  • 269a59c1e2 feat(whatsapp_business): made vcard path dynamic Andres Rodriguez 2023-08-15 00:36:15 -04:00
  • d8b434e169 feat(whatsapp_business)!: args and default values for smb Andres Rodriguez 2023-08-15 00:35:32 -04:00
  • 326b99d860 feat(whatsapp_business)!: extraction script for smb Andres Rodriguez 2023-08-15 00:32:07 -04:00
  • bd2f063cc0 Bug fix on calls without chat #58 KnugiHK 2023-08-12 15:51:05 +08:00
  • 736292538b Update the command for macOS #55 Knugi 2023-07-25 08:53:04 +00:00
  • d772efe779 Update the sample output screenshot KnugiHK 2023-06-25 20:01:06 +08:00
  • 282c99c7dd PyPi can't have git source as dependency 0.9.5 KnugiHK 2023-06-25 13:57:11 +08:00
  • 8dec2a7e97 Bug fix on missing attribute in the Message class. KnugiHK 2023-06-25 13:30:44 +08:00
  • f9dedc7930 Increase the row size KnugiHK 2023-06-25 13:14:39 +08:00
  • e2f497dbb6 Bug fix on exported chat KnugiHK 2023-06-25 12:42:37 +08:00
  • 989bddca37 Limit the reply quote length KnugiHK 2023-06-21 17:24:50 +08:00
  • 40d060628f Coding style KnugiHK 2023-06-21 17:04:58 +08:00
  • 032af6cdcf Refactor KnugiHK 2023-06-21 17:01:14 +08:00
  • e243abe2a4 Bug fix KnugiHK 2023-06-21 16:52:39 +08:00
  • b8f0af5f31 Refactor KnugiHK 2023-06-21 16:24:36 +08:00
  • 030fef53e1 I found that old schema also has such tables KnugiHK 2023-06-20 19:53:05 +08:00
  • 3ed269e17f Support a lot of metadata in Android's new schema KnugiHK 2023-06-20 19:12:38 +08:00
  • 1e3ee5e322 Fix incorrect group message sender name KnugiHK 2023-06-20 16:03:24 +08:00
  • 6c740e69a5 Fix wrongly determined metadata KnugiHK 2023-06-20 15:32:05 +08:00
  • 828c8a1a72 Fix only one group chat is rendered when contact db is not present KnugiHK 2023-06-20 15:31:24 +08:00
  • 1fb8588752 Add more alias to wtsexporter command KnugiHK 2023-06-20 14:58:44 +08:00
  • 6636210e4c Fix the reply jump offset after introducing status KnugiHK 2023-06-20 14:52:32 +08:00
  • cc0105647a Refactor a bit KnugiHK 2023-06-20 14:50:57 +08:00
  • 4fa360a389 No longer support direct execution on the script KnugiHK 2023-06-20 14:41:31 +08:00
  • e5228855d2 Temporary workaround mentioned in #48 KnugiHK 2023-06-20 14:39:54 +08:00
  • db1cdf8189 Add contact's status if present (iOS) KnugiHK 2023-06-20 14:37:25 +08:00
  • 08ce61e68e Make them optional when importing! KnugiHK 2023-06-20 14:37:12 +08:00
  • 138dd5351f Add status to JSON import KnugiHK 2023-06-20 14:19:07 +08:00
  • 136152dc18 Add contact's status if present (Android) KnugiHK 2023-06-20 14:07:42 +08:00
  • 55bc62cdc1 Add fallback to Android contact name just like commit 5f6b764 KnugiHK 2023-06-20 13:49:22 +08:00
  • d430c7bfba Update wording on progress KnugiHK 2023-06-19 20:40:10 +08:00
  • 672b85474e Bug fix on the wrong type of media_wa_type in old Android schema KnugiHK 2023-06-19 20:26:13 +08:00
  • 525d88f2c6 Fix < Python 3.11 compatibility KnugiHK 2023-06-19 20:09:45 +08:00
  • b57087794a Bump version for preparing next release KnugiHK 2023-06-19 17:56:24 +08:00
  • be316ebb89 Add aliases to extras_require KnugiHK 2023-06-18 15:15:39 +08:00
  • 1078f7e5f7 Bug fix on sticker not resizing KnugiHK 2023-06-18 15:10:00 +08:00
  • ba2a88067a Update setup.py KnugiHK 2023-06-18 14:36:15 +08:00
  • af53ba978b Merge branch 'main' into dev KnugiHK 2023-06-16 19:27:56 +08:00
  • d55a42a549 Merge pull request #36 from nahoj/patch-1 Knugi 2023-06-16 19:27:34 +08:00
  • 506f8e89f4 Implement import json and output HTML KnugiHK 2023-06-16 19:19:33 +08:00
  • fff11b26a5 Store the device type KnugiHK 2023-06-16 19:12:06 +08:00
  • fa66ef3a52 Output all attribute to JSON file KnugiHK 2023-06-16 19:11:55 +08:00
  • 0b93ae567e rephrase as suggested Johan Grande 2023-06-16 12:38:38 +02:00
  • c62e07cb0a Merge branch 'main' into patch-1 Johan Grande 2023-06-16 12:33:17 +02:00
  • 317d785d50 Bug fix on raise of exception when "media_folder" does not exists on the filesystem KnugiHK 2023-06-16 18:27:49 +08:00
  • 38c1e47be9 Add iphone-backup-decrypt to setup.py as extra dependency KnugiHK 2023-06-16 17:57:33 +08:00
  • ff95625edf Dropping Python 3.7 and adding Python 3.11 support KnugiHK 2023-06-16 17:50:08 +08:00
  • 14854193bd Merge branch 'main' into dev KnugiHK 2023-06-16 14:26:34 +08:00
  • 67c1b43669 Update README.md KnugiHK 2023-06-16 14:07:04 +08:00
  • 23046e01ba Add links to README KnugiHK 2023-06-16 13:48:36 +08:00
  • c366e656af Further reduce the maximum length of vcard file name #51 KnugiHK 2023-06-16 01:46:27 +08:00
  • 41f45fb07c PEP8 KnugiHK 2023-06-16 01:43:43 +08:00
  • be9e790b12 Better handling of binary message #44 KnugiHK 2023-06-16 01:25:51 +08:00
  • bfdc68cd6a Add autoescape to rendering KnugiHK 2023-06-16 01:10:24 +08:00
  • 594a04adbc Update the way to handle encrypted iOS backup file KnugiHK 2023-06-15 21:32:57 +08:00
  • 20b2eec047 Support Android call logs KnugiHK 2023-06-15 18:25:29 +08:00
  • 011c8ff1e7 Support missed call (PM) metadata for Android KnugiHK 2023-06-15 17:44:38 +08:00
  • e4c47ea41f Update whatsapp.html KnugiHK 2023-06-15 17:01:13 +08:00
  • c344f05b05 Bug fix on wrong alias KnugiHK 2023-06-15 17:00:55 +08:00
  • 88ef4989fc Fix wrong error message KnugiHK 2023-06-15 17:00:34 +08:00
  • f7f6b01c86 Resize sticker KnugiHK 2023-06-15 16:59:54 +08:00
  • a49a911e03 Replace image rendered in the HTML to thumbnail if possible KnugiHK 2023-06-15 16:19:35 +08:00
  • 3443143744 Restore code for downloading media from whatsapp server KnugiHK 2023-06-15 02:16:53 +08:00
  • 5f6b764bb9 Add fallback to iOS contact name KnugiHK 2023-06-14 21:53:23 +08:00
  • 3940b2991f Try to reduce the size of the template KnugiHK 2023-06-13 21:23:44 +08:00
  • dc1df8a03e Just coding style KnugiHK 2023-06-13 19:48:31 +08:00
  • dd5ec2219c Sync changes KnugiHK 2023-06-13 19:46:09 +08:00
  • e0c2cf5f66 Implement iOS avatar #48 KnugiHK 2023-06-13 19:44:16 +08:00
  • 8cdb694a16 Modify the root directory name of iOS media KnugiHK 2023-06-13 17:00:40 +08:00
  • 8294f06587 Extract whole WhatsApp directory instead of wanted files only KnugiHK 2023-06-13 16:29:27 +08:00
  • 200dea218f Update help message KnugiHK 2023-06-13 14:01:10 +08:00
  • df93033c6c Update README.md Knugi 2023-06-13 05:54:14 +00:00
  • 8f90733da2 Change "Gathering" to "Processing" KnugiHK 2023-06-11 01:35:40 +08:00
  • 3fdf6d0818 Update LICENSE KnugiHK 2023-06-11 01:33:09 +08:00
  • 2fa5c4268e Rewrite a bit KnugiHK 2023-06-11 01:22:21 +08:00
  • ed658d78dc Fix incorrect media path on iOS #49 KnugiHK 2023-06-11 01:21:07 +08:00
  • 0280325b4a Bug fix KnugiHK 2023-06-11 00:47:11 +08:00
  • a42ec5d762 Beautify KnugiHK 2023-06-10 19:58:14 +08:00
  • c419dd5d39 Raise error if time is not str and int KnugiHK 2023-06-10 19:54:09 +08:00
  • 8d036a6d87 Rewrite a bit KnugiHK 2023-06-10 19:45:29 +08:00
  • 42435c38cc Add <br> to newline KnugiHK 2023-06-10 19:32:48 +08:00
  • 32caab7c40 Distinguish between media missing and media omitted KnugiHK 2023-06-10 19:32:38 +08:00
  • 0897dc2897 Implement export TXT chat #22 KnugiHK 2023-06-10 19:24:39 +08:00
  • f63b180500 Implement splitted outputs #23 KnugiHK 2023-06-08 18:16:47 +08:00
  • dbdfdaedcf Refine code to use the data model KnugiHK 2023-06-08 17:51:57 +08:00
  • 0e802f4554 Remove old file KnugiHK 2023-06-08 16:50:33 +08:00
  • 41dd5e545f Make the not supported note looks less intimidating KnugiHK 2023-06-08 15:46:12 +08:00
  • 8750315e8e Update __main__.py KnugiHK 2023-06-02 02:41:06 +08:00
  • e9499c3bb7 Add highlighting when navigate to replied message KnugiHK 2023-06-02 02:41:01 +08:00
  • 80c3ed11f6 Partially implement reply feature in iOS KnugiHK 2023-06-02 01:27:05 +08:00
  • 7c78cce221 Update link for reporting offsets KnugiHK 2023-06-01 22:26:32 +08:00
  • 32a312d332 Add offset mentioned in #46 KnugiHK 2023-06-01 22:21:58 +08:00
  • 328f34e632 Merge branch 'main' into dev KnugiHK 2023-05-19 13:25:21 +08:00
  • 9ac8839ecc Workaround for non-UTF8 message KnugiHK 2023-05-19 13:23:51 +08:00